## Retry safety in Paylark plugins

Quick heads-up before you ship: every retry against the Paylark charge endpoint must reuse the original idempotency key, or you'll double-bill merchants (ask the Fernwick team how that week went). Generate the key once per logical payment, stash it with the order, and pass it on every attempt. Our release script verifies your plugin bundle before publishing. To sign the bundle, use the key below.

release key, fajef-kajeg: bky19_LdLu6Ne6FLi8he2c24d

Transcode farm (Quillvid cluster) drops ~2% of HEVC jobs under load. Workers mark the job complete but output is zero bytes. Suspect race in the Splicewright queue ack path after the retry patch. Repro: saturate node pool, submit 500 mixed-codec jobs, check for empty outputs. Workaround: re-queue empties via the sweeper cron. Do not raise worker concurrency until fixed — it widens the window. Affected builds share one farm revision; the trace token for the failing revision follows below.

session token of tajef-bageg = htk21_5d90d574934f3ccae6437

Subject: Ledger cut-over complete

Quick summary for you as you ramp up: the Copperquill loyalty-points ledger is now fully on the new Drossvale cluster. Old writes stopped at midnight, backfill verified, checksums matched. Read traffic flipped this morning with no errors. Don't touch the legacy tables; they're frozen for audit. For your local setup, the configuration the service now runs with is listed below.

service settings:
[casax]
port = 6379
team = rusir
host = casax.zemvarhq.corp
region = outer-4
access_code = ac_9808ce
timeout_ms = 1500

Ticket QB-1142: Secrets vault locked mid-upgrade

While upgrading the Mistrel message broker from 4.x to 5.0, the credentials vault auto-locked after the node restart, and the broker can't fetch its TLS material. Reviewer: please confirm the attached patch re-seals the vault correctly after unlock, and that the upgrade script no longer restarts nodes before re-authenticating. To reproduce locally, bring up the staging vault, apply the patch, and unlock with the recovery passphrase given below.

unlock words, hahip-baduf: holwyn-istath-julvan